What this credit is
Complimentary Priority Pass Select membership with access for the Cardmember plus up to 2 guests; enrollment required.

How the one-time reset works
It does not reset. A one-off. Once it is used, or once the offer period closes, it is finished — so this one belongs on a calendar rather than in a habit.

Where people lose this one
- Enrolment required. This credit does not apply automatically — you have to activate it before the spend, and activation does not backdate.
- Requires a paid membership. Part of the value is only reachable if you keep the underlying subscription active, so net it out before counting it.
